DO NOT buy German and Swedish top mounts, I replaced mine about 6 months ago when I fitted my Eibach springs and now the car is really skittish and theres a tight spot in the steering, I removed the plastic covers from the top mounts and theres a huge gap, the rubber has sunk and the mount has no play in it, also the bearing is tight which is playing havoc on the steering. I will be replacing them this week with original parts.
As for the strut top mounts, there are 2 part numbers listed on ETKA, I think one is for normal golfs and the other is for cars like the Rallye and the Country, I assume the rubber is a slightly harder compound to cope with the extra stresses placed on the car from having 4 wheel drive. On ETKA the following becomes clear.
strut top mounting. 191 412 329 normal models.
strut top mounting 357 412 341 PG engine number.
The PG engine code is the code of the super charger engine fitted to Rallye and G60.
So going by this it would indicate that the higher performing golfs have harder compound rubber for the strut top mounts. Also its interesting to note that the spring top cap that holds the top of the spring and which the mount sits on also is different on the PG engined vehicles so maybe this also is made of stronger metal.
